Title: Elad Einav: Innovator in Biliary Stent Technology
Introduction
Elad Einav is a notable inventor based in Salit, Israel. He has made significant contributions to the field of medical devices, particularly in the development of biliary stents. With a total of 3 patents to his name, Einav's work has the potential to improve patient outcomes in medical procedures.
Latest Patents
Einav's latest patents include innovative designs for the deployment of multiple biliary stents. One of his patents describes a guide tube that features a guidewire-engaging portion at its distal end. This design allows for the first stent to be deployed off the distal end of the guide tube as the guidewire exits laterally. Additionally, a second stent can be deployed without moving the guidewire proximally. Another patent focuses on methods and assemblies for deploying biliary stents, which includes a stent-deployment assembly that utilizes a guidewire and an elongated stent-conveyance tube. This assembly is designed to facilitate the advancement of the stent into a body lumen, ensuring effective deployment at the target location.
Career Highlights
Elad Einav is currently associated with Endo Gi Medical Ltd., where he continues to innovate in the medical device sector. His work is characterized by a commitment to enhancing the functionality and effectiveness of biliary stents.
Collaborations
Einav collaborates with talented professionals in his field, including Ronny Barak and Omri Naveh. Their combined expertise contributes to the advancement of medical technologies.
